Concrete stairs construction services involve the design and installation of durable, functional stairways made primarily from concrete. This service typically includes preparing the site, forming the stairs with appropriate dimensions, pouring the concrete, and finishing the surface for safety and aesthetic appeal. Whether replacing old, worn stairs or installing new ones for a renovation project, experienced contractors ensure the structure is solid, level, and built to withstand daily use. Proper construction not only enhances the appearance of a property but also provides a long-lasting solution for access between different levels of a home or outdoor space.
Many property owners turn to concrete stairs construction to address common problems such as uneven or cracked existing stairs, safety hazards, or insufficient access points. In older homes or properties with deteriorated stairs, replacing or repairing the stairs can prevent accidents and improve overall safety. For outdoor steps, concrete offers weather resistance and minimal maintenance, making it an ideal choice for patios, garden paths, or entryways. The overview below groups typical Concrete Stairs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in New Lenox,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or concrete stair repairs in the New Lenox area range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as patching or resurfacing, fall within this range, though prices can vary based on the extent of damage.
Standard Replacement - Replacing existing concrete stairs usually costs between $1,200 and $3,500. Most projects of this size are priced within this band, with factors like size and design influencing the final cost.
Custom or Complex Projects - Larger or more intricate concrete stair projects can reach $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Fewer projects fall into this high-tier range, typically involving custom designs or challenging site conditions.
Material and Design Variations - Costs can fluctuate based on materials, finishes, and added features, with premium options potentially increasing the price. Local contractors can provide estimates tailored to specific project details within these typical ranges.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ete stairs do local contractors typically build? They can construct various types, including straight, spiral, and L-shaped stairs, tailored to fit different architectural styles and functional needs.
Are there design options available for concrete stairs? Yes, local service providers often offer options such as textured finishes, decorative patterns, and custom dimensions to match the property's aesthetic.
What is involved in the process of constructing concrete stairs? The process generally includes site preparation, form creation, reinforcement placement, pouring and finishing the concrete, followed by curing to ensure durability.
Can local contractors handle stairs for both residential and commercial properties? Yes, many service providers are experienced in building concrete stairs suitable for homes, businesses, and public spaces.
What maintenance is required for concrete stairs built by local contractors? Routine inspections for cracks or damage and cleaning to prevent buildup are common maintenance steps to preserve their condition.
